Report: Jaguars make first practice squad signing

The Jaguars are signing linebacker Tanner Muse to their practice squad, per Tom Pelissero of NFL Network.

Muse’s signing marks Jacksonville’s first reported addition to its 2024 practice squad.

Jacksonville released Muse on Monday amid the club’s preseason roster cutdowns, following his first preseason with the club. He signed with the Jaguars during training camp in July.

Muse recorded five tackles and one defended pass over 68 total snaps and three games this preseason.

A third-round pick by the Raiders in 2020, Muse has recorded 22 tackles and one defended pass in 33 regular season games, with  Las Vegas, Seattle, Pittsburgh and the Los Angeles Chargers.

Muse starred alongside Jaguars quarterback Trevor Lawrence and running back Travis Etienne Jr. from 2018-19 during his five-year career at Clemson, where he played safety.

The former third-team All-American and two-time All-ACC third-team defensive back logged 192 tackles including 10.5 for loss, four sacks, seven interceptions, 21 defended passes and one forced fumble over 58 games with the Tigers.
